WebBirths in 2024 by race/ethnicity [ edit] Notes Data are by place of residence. Data reflect race and Latino origin of the infant's mother. Race and Latino origin are reported separately on birth certificates; persons of Latino origin may be of any race. In this table, non-Latino women are classified by race. WebThe National Center for Health Statistics provides annual counts of births in the United States, as compiled in the National Vital Statistics System from data derived from birth certificates. Webmajority of midwives in the United States are CNMs. 1 In 2024, CNMs/CMs attended 351,968 births—a slight increase compared to 2016. In 2024, CNMs/CMs attended 85% of all midwife-attended births 2and 9.1% of total US births. (2024 is the most recent year for which birth data are available from the National Center for Health Statistics.) WebJul 11, 2024 · In the United States in 2024, about 10,267 babies were born each day. That's 1 percent less than in 2024 and the fifth year in a row that the number of births has declined. Preliminary data for 2024 show another decline in birth numbers – this time of 4 percent, which will be the lowest number of births since 1979.
